The Amazon Web Services Professional Services (ProServe) team is looking for an experienced Sales Manager ProServe (SMP) to lead a team of ProServe Account Executives and Cloud Architects. You'll drive transformative IT projects for clients, focusing on IT Strategy, distributed architecture, and hybrid cloud operations. The SMP is a trusted advisor who collaborates with ProServe sales and delivery teams to ensure sellers are working backwards from our customers and proposing solutions that optimize the delivery of customer business outcomes. SMPs support customer relationship management while enabling sellers to lead sales activity, ensuring customer satisfaction for a defined set of customers and partners. SMPs are primarily focused on delivering outcomes through their teams, removing roadblocks, and ensuring teams have the tools and support to achieve their goals.
As an experienced Professional Services Sales Leader, you will be responsible for:
1. Leading and developing a high-performing team of Account Executives and Cloud Architects
2. Developing and supporting execution of sales strategies to meet team targets and drive revenue growth
3. Managing customer relationships, ensuring high satisfaction and identifying new opportunities
4. Leveraging deep AWS knowledge to guide sellers in proposing optimal solutions
5. Monitoring and analyzing key performance indicators, ensuring accurate reporting and forecasting to optimize operational processes and manage risk
Your experience gained within the technology sector will equip you with the ability to translate technical concepts into business value for customers. You will demonstrate proficiency in sales methodologies and CRM systems coupled with strong analytical, problem-solving, and project management abilities. SMPs will be measured on the performance of their team/practice against key metrics including but not limited to Revenue, Billable Bookings, team engagement, and customer satisfaction (CSAT).

The AWS Professional Services organization is a global team of experts that help customers realize their desired business outcomes when using the AWS Cloud. We work together with customer teams and the AWS Partner Network (APN) to execute enterprise cloud computing initiatives. Our team provides assistance through a collection of offerings which help customers achieve specific outcomes related to enterprise cloud adoption. We also deliver focused guidance through our global specialty practices, which cover a variety of solutions, technologies, and industries.
